
Haouari Boumediene
Haouari Boumediene was an Algerian military officer who played a crucial role in the Algerian War of Independence and later became the second President of Algeria. He was instrumental in organizing the Algerian National Liberation Army and was known for his leadership during the conflict against French colonial rule. Boumediene's military strategies and reforms significantly shaped Algeria's post-independence era.
